This is a huge potential problem that I hope gets addressed with future updates. I think with the nature of the nexus upgrade - the amount of light you obtain needs to be constantly re-evaluated.
On one hand, the Nexus bit is nice - no relying on RNG, no need to wait for hours on end for just one specific content. On the other though, the whole thing from atma onwards is a mindless grindfest, and that's just not my personal definition of fun at all - sure, from the outside it's great that it makes older and open world content more alive, but from the inside I was literally braindead just by the time I finished atma. So...er...yeah, definitely a double-bladed sword.
It's quite bad, just a grind sending you back into old content to keep you busy. Nobody does primals hundreds of times or westwind 2000 times just for the fun of it. It's something you endure for the prize at the end. The best thing they could do is add relic-specific original content, like they did with Hydra and Chimera. But I understand they don't have all the time in the world. Maybe the last ever relic quest could have an original boss instead of rehashed old content to make it more memorable.
